About Parkton, North Carolina

Parkton is a locality in Robeson County, North Carolina, United States. It is a small community with a population of 529. The population density is 255.0 people per km². Parkton is located at 34.9027°N, 79.0117°W. It observes the Eastern Time (America/New_York) timezone. ZIP code: 28371.

It lies 12.8 miles south-west of Fayetteville, NC (from Fayetteville, NC: bearing 216°T), and is situated 6.0 miles south-west of Hope Mills.
